Bielawa's Undertones is the only absolute music on the disc. The title is a vague indication of the composer's compositional technique… but the work is so aggressive and dramatic that one does not worry over how he got there. |

The disc is worth having just for the Quodlibet SF 42569 of Herbert Bielawa. This is an impressive piece, one which married the electronic sounds to those of the organ in a remarkable way. |
